The Olde Towne Slidell Merchants Association hosts its 49th annual St. Patricks Day parade on March 12. With hundreds of men walking in kilts and handing out plastic carnations, dozens of decorated floats with riders tossing cabbages, Moon Pies, and Irish Spring soap bars, its a fun and festive day. During the 1830s, the Irish were the labor that built the New Basin Canal, a shipping canal that connected Uptown with Lake Pontchartrain. The parade route starts at Magazine Street and Jackson Avenue, heads lake bound on Jackson Avenue, heads towards Uptown on St. Charles Avenue, river bound on Louisiana Avenue, heads towards downtown on Magazine Street and finishes after turning river bound on Jackson Avenue.
